The 2007 Ford Fiesta First Sedan is a compact vehicle equipped with a 1.6L naturally aspirated inline-4 engine. Known for its fuel efficiency and practicality, this sedan features front-wheel drive and a four-door body style, making it suitable for urban commuting and everyday use. While it delivers reliable performance, owners should be aware of common issues and maintenance practices to ensure the longevity of their vehicle.

Common Issues

Owners of the 2007 Ford Fiesta may encounter issues such as premature wear of suspension components, electrical system malfunctions, and transmission problems. Additionally, some drivers report minor oil leaks and coolant system concerns.

Maintenance Tips

Regular maintenance is key to keeping your Fiesta running smoothly. Ensure timely oil changes, check tire pressure regularly, and replace air filters as needed. It's also essential to inspect brake pads and rotors periodically to maintain safety and performance.

Typical Repair/Owership Cost Ranges

Repair costs for the 2007 Ford Fiesta can range from $300 to $1,200 depending on the service needed. Routine maintenance, such as oil changes and brake replacements, typically falls between $50 and $300. Overall ownership costs, including insurance and fuel, can average around $1,500 to $2,500 annually.

Buying Advice (What to Inspect)

When considering a used 2007 Ford Fiesta, inspect the vehicle for any signs of rust or body damage, check the condition of the tires and brakes, and verify that all electrical components function properly. Additionally, review the maintenance history and consider a pre-purchase inspection by a qualified mechanic.

FAQ

What is the fuel economy of the 2007 Ford Fiesta? The 2007 Ford Fiesta typically achieves around 28-35 MPG, depending on driving conditions.

How reliable is the 2007 Ford Fiesta? Generally, the 2007 Fiesta is considered reliable, but regular maintenance is crucial to avoid common issues.

What type of oil should I use for the 2007 Ford Fiesta? It is recommended to use 5W-20 synthetic blend oil for optimal performance.

Are parts for the 2007 Ford Fiesta readily available? Yes, parts for the 2007 Fiesta are widely available and relatively inexpensive due to the vehicle's popularity.

How often should I change the timing belt on the 2007 Ford Fiesta? The timing belt should be replaced every 60,000 to 100,000 miles, depending on driving conditions.

What is the average lifespan of a 2007 Ford Fiesta? With proper maintenance, the 2007 Fiesta can last over 200,000 miles.

How much does it cost to replace the brake pads? Replacing brake pads on a 2007 Ford Fiesta typically costs between $150 and $300, depending on the service provider.

What should I do if my Fiesta is overheating? If your Fiesta is overheating, check the coolant level and look for leaks. It's best to consult a mechanic if issues persist.
